Vermin removal services involve professional efforts to identify, eliminate, and prevent pests such as rats, mice, squirrels, and other unwanted rodents or critters from residential or commercial properties. These specialists assess the extent of an infestation, employ targeted techniques to remove pests safely and effectively, and implement strategies to reduce the likelihood of future visits. The process often includes setting traps, sealing entry points, and advising on measures to keep pests from returning, ensuring a pest-free environment for occupants.
These services help solve a variety of problems caused by vermin, including property damage, contamination, and health risks. Rodents can chew through wiring, insulation, and structural elements, leading to costly repairs. They may also carry diseases or parasites that pose health hazards to residents or employees. Vermin can be a source of ongoing nuisance, creating noise, unpleasant odors, and a general feeling of discomfort. Professional removal aims to address both the immediate pest problem and underlying causes to restore safety and comfort.

The overview below groups typical Vermin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or vermin removal, such as trapping or small exterminations, range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the pest type and property size.
Moderate Projects - Larger infestations or extensive treatments us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ects often involve multiple visits or more comprehensive methods, with fewer jobs reaching higher prices.
Full Property Treatments - Complete eradication of pests across an entire property can range from $1,500 to $3,500. Service providers often perform detailed inspections and multiple treatments for these larger projects.
Full Replacement or Structural Repairs - In cases where pest damage requires structural work or full replacements, costs can exceed $5,000. Such projects are less common and involve extensive work by specialized local contractors.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
